goodMRKT Live! showcases the inspirational stories behind the brands at goodMRKT. Every brand at goodMRKT is dedicated to doing good and each founder has an incredible story to share. With goodMRKT Live! we are bringing you those amazing stories straight from the founders themselves.

Each week, our hosts Harry Cunningham, Mary Beth Trypus, and Adam Taft Lambert will explore the stories around us through the eyes of the people who dare to make a difference and discover how purpose-driven companies are changing the world for the better.

This week on goodMRKT Live! Harry and Adam are joined by Leisha Pickering, the founder of Musee, a company making natural, handcrafted bath products from the heart of Madison County, Mississippi. To craft their bath products, Musee uses a workforce made up of vulnerable people from their community, primarily hiring women in recovery, people with disabilities, and others who have lived in chronic poverty.

In their conversation, Leisha shares the story Musee’s beginnings making bath balms in the kitchen, her reasoning for working with women in recovery, and why being compassionate might be the most courageous thing we ever do.

This week on goodMRKT Live! Harry and Adam catch up with Michelle Tunno Buelow. Michelle is the founder of Bella Tunno, a company that creates incredibly charming baby products and is dedicated to ending childhood hunger. For every product that Bella Tunno sells, they donate one meal, to one child, somewhere across the world.

Michelle was gracious enough to share the emotional backstory that inspired her to create Bella Tunno, talk about how childhood hunger can lead to addiction in adults, and explain what it feels like to have donated more than six-point two million meals to children across the planet.
